Portable Electric and Cordless Drill
• Be sure the electric drill is disconnected from the power source before installing bits.
• Make sure the bit is sharpened before use.
• Make sure the chuck key has been removed before starting the drill
• Secure all work before drilling.
• Use a center punch or scratch awl to mark a starter hole.

Finishing Sander
• Always disconnect the cord before changing abrasive sheets.
• Do Not touch the bottom of the sander while it is in operation
• Always secure your work before sanding.
• Always wear eye protection.

Random Orbit Sander
• Always disconnect the cord before changing abrasive discs.
• Do Not touch the bottom of the sander while it is in operation.
• Always secure your work before sanding.
• The bottom of this sander rotates in a circular motion. This tool can and will cut into skin with the slightest touch.

Belt Sander
• Always secure the work piece. Never hold the stock with your body!!!
• Do not force the tool or put down pressure on it.
• Before plugging in the tool check to see that the tool is turned off.
![Page 6: Portable Power Tool Safety. Portable Electric and Cordless Drill Be sure the electric drill is disconnected from the power source before installing bits](https://reader036.vd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022062421/56649c8a5503460f949446df/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
Belt Sander (II)
• Hold the tool by the correct handles with both hands and always maintain a firm grip.
• Wear safety glasses.• Never wear loose
clothing around this machine.

Circular Saw
• Always make sure the switch is off before plugging in the tool.
• Rest the large portion of the base on the piece of stock that will remain stationary.
• Keep hands and fingers away from rotating parts.
• Always wear safety glasses.
• Never attempt to cut curves.

Portable Jig Saw
• Always make sure the switch is off before plugging the tool in.
• Never change the blades with the machine plugged in.
• Keep hands and fingers away from the blade.
• Never force the blade into the work piece.
• Always wear safety glasses.

Router
• Select the appropriate bit and adjust to proper depth.
• Only use the wrenches designed for the machine to tighten and loosen the collet.
• Always secure the work piece
• Make trial cuts first.• Keep hands away from the
cutter.

Router (II)
• Hold router firmly in both hands.
• Never force the router into the work piece.
• Always wait for the router to come to a complete stop before setting down on its side or the top base.
• Always wear safety glasses!!!

Plate Jointer
• Before plugging the tool in, make sure it is in the off position.
• Always keep the guards in place.
• Keep hands away from the front of the tool and the cutter head
• Do not cut in to knots or hardware.
• Release the switch if the blade binds or stops.
• Always wear safety glasses.

Pneumatic Nailer
• Always disconnect the tool to load fasteners
• Never point this tool at anyone
• Keep all hands away from the fastener ejection area
• Keep all hands away from the direction at which the fastener will enter into the part. The nail can come through and enter ones body.
